网站开发邮件服务器湖南疫情最新消息今天
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档
文章目录
- 前言
- 一、pandas是什么?
- 二、使用步骤
- 1.引入库
- 2.读入数据
- 总结
前言
提示:这里可以添加本文要记录的大概内容:
例如:随着人工智能的不断发展,机器学习这门技术也越来越重要,很多人都开启了学习机器学习,本文就介绍了机器学习的基础内容。
提示:以下是本篇文章正文内容,下面案例可供参考
一、前期疑惑
在学习systick志气啊,其实对于systick还是一脸懵的。然后自己在想的过程中,就产生了几个疑问,下面表述一下。
1、systick是终内部中断?如果是的话,中断中要干什么,终端中怎么处理的,来实现定时的。
2、systick是怎么实现定时的?
3、systick延时是阻塞的吗?
4、systick用的是哪个时钟。外部还是内部,只能用HSE吗
二、解答
2.1 关于systick是阻塞的吗?
这个问题感觉变得复杂了起来。systick野火教程中是阻塞的。然后jd之前的代码是非阻塞的。但是我已经完全记不清楚jd非阻塞的代码是怎么写的了。好像是使用了if(getSystickCount() - count > 0)类似语句。
可是问题来了,getSystickCount()函数是从哪里获取计数值呢?
2.2 非阻塞
刚才看了下jd的代码,主要是看了下非阻塞的代码。他是在中断中对systickCount++。然后在裸机主循环loop中轮询获取systickCount的值。比如获取systickCount值的函数是getSystickCount()函数。
int startTick = 0;if(getSystickCount() - startTick > delay_ms)
{startTick = getSystickCount();//控制led操作//
}
总结
提示:这里对文章进行总结:
例如:以上就是今天要讲的内容,本文仅仅简单介绍了pandas的使用,而pandas提供了大量能使我们快速便捷地处理数据的函数和方法。